捆绑包中存在未密封的内容 - Mac版本

时间:2015-12-03 13:12:14

标签: macos node-webkit node-webkit-agent

我试图在Mac上使用nwjs签署我的应用版本。 https://github.com/nwjs/nw.js/wiki/MAS:-Signing-the-app

以下是我尝试的步骤。最多7个步骤中的7个为我工作。当我运行第8个命令时 "捆绑根目录中存在未密封的内容"错误信息。

1. export IDENTITY= "*******" 
2. export PARENT_PLIST=/path/to/parent.plist
3. export CHILD_PLIST=/path/to/child.plist
4. export APP_PATH=/path/to/yourapp/YourApp.app

5. codesign --deep -s $IDENTITY --entitlements $CHILD_PLIST $APP_PATH"/Contents/Frameworks/nwjs Helper.app"

6. codesign --deep -s $IDENTITY --entitlements $CHILD_PLIST $APP_PATH"/Contents/Frameworks/nwjs Helper EH.app"

7. codesign --deep -s $IDENTITY --entitlements $CHILD_PLIST $APP_PATH"/Contents/Frameworks/nwjs Helper NP.app"

8. codesign --deep -s $IDENTITY --entitlements $PARENT_PLIST $APP_PATH 

请参阅我的文件结构的屏幕截图

enter image description here

0 个答案:

没有答案